Put in the RFCs for RIPv1 and RIPv2.
Handle an address family of 0; that means that the address wasn't specified in the request, which is used for a "send me the whole routing table" request. Replace some "proto_tree_add_XXX" calls with "proto_tree_add_item" calls. Use FALSE, rather than TRUE, as the byte order argument in one "proto_tree_add_item" call, for consistency with other calls; the field is a string, so the byte order doesn't matter. svn path=/trunk/; revision=5099
